Reactive distillation: On the development of an integrated design methodology. Almeida-Rivera, C. & Grievink, J. Chemie-Ingenieur-Technik, 73(6):609, 2001.
abstract   bibtex   
A novel internal was developed to enlarge the void of the reactor section and provide the gas and liquid flow channels. The catalytic distillation column with the internal has advantages that include simple internal structure, low operating cost, loading and unloading catalyst conveniently, and large catalyst loading fraction.
